Up until now, neighborhoods once characterized by two-story houses, gardens and ground- floor open shopfront programs, have been completely transformed by the introduction of fortressed monolithic residential and office towers, which lack any sort of urban street life.
The new master-plan, however, now requires buildings to have an open street façade to accommodate multiple programs. Led by tutors from UNStudio (www.unstudio.com), the AA Visiting School São Paulo will address the changes being prescribed by the new masterplan through the redefinition of the tower typology in the extending of the ground of street culture, green landscapes and ecological mediation along the vertical axis of these buildings. For this, the workshop will teach advanced digital design and fabrication techniques to explore a series of novel differentiating structural and environmental organizations in the redefinition of the São Paulo skyscraper.

The whole "specification tree" a la Catia where there is a clear child parent hierarchy of grasshopper components would, I agree be great. The ability for constraint based modelling is also great.
However, grasshopper is not a true constraint based parametric modeler like CATIA.
It is also a generative algorithm editor and really shouldn't be compared to tools like CATIA. It could be argued its primary purpose is as a means of providing a visual scripting alternative to traditional text based scripts. I would also argue Grasshopepr itself is very flexible in providing a bespoke blank canvas to set up work flows between different tools such as Catia/excel. This is something I see no other solution out there that can do this.
I love CATIA but however great it is, it is an extremely heavy and unfocussed piece of software. Until Dassault take it seriously as an alternative to REVIT and produce a light-weight version, its dead in the water as regards realistic implementation in the AEC world. 99% of the work benches you don't need for AEC work.
